About Nazareth Home
Nazareth Home is a nonprofit, award-winning long-term care and rehabilitation community dedicated to providing compassionate, person-centered health and wellness services to adults and their families.
Established in 1976 and sponsored by the Sisters of Charity of Nazareth, Nazareth Home operates two vibrant campuses in Louisville, Kentucky: the Highlands Campus at 2000 Newburg Road and the Clifton Campus at 2120 Payne Street.
Services Offered
The organization offers a comprehensive range of services tailored to meet the diverse needs of its residents, including:
- Personal Care: Assistance with daily activities to support independence and quality of life.
- Memory Care: Specialized programs for individuals with Alzheimer's disease and other memory-related conditions.
- Long-Term Care: Skilled nursing services for those requiring ongoing medical attention.
- Recovery to Home: Rehabilitation services designed to help individuals regain independence after illness or surgery.
- Independent Living: Private one-bedroom apartments offering a maintenance-free lifestyle with access to community amenities.
Approach to Care
Nazareth Home emphasizes a holistic approach to care, integrating social, recreational, spiritual, educational, and cultural activities to enrich the lives of its residents.
Engaging programs include group outings to local sites like Slugger Field and Churchill Downs, partnerships with The Kentucky Center for the Arts, and access to large print or audio books from the Louisville Free Public Library.
Additionally, residents have access to iPads for personal use, ensuring they stay connected and engaged.
Community Features
The organization is committed to fostering a sense of community and belonging.
Both campuses feature neighborhood-style living with all private rooms, nutritious dining options, ample outdoor green spaces, and on-site chapels offering Mass six days a week, along with spiritual opportunities for other faiths.
Recognition and Facilities
Nazareth Home has been recognized for its excellence in care, receiving high ratings in both short-term rehabilitation and long-term care categories.
The Highlands Campus has 168 licensed beds and offers inpatient and outpatient rehabilitation services.
Training and Careers
For those interested in pursuing a career in healthcare, Nazareth Home provides free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) training programs.
This program prepares individuals for full-time employment within the organization and includes classroom instruction and hands-on clinical training, emphasizing person-centered care in long-term and rehabilitation settings.
